Our energy system is on the brink of a major transformation, and there's no denying that change is crucial. Digitization plays a key role in this shift towards a decarbonized and decentralized energy network. It enables greater integration of renewable sources, empowers consumers to become active prosumers, and provides utilities with real-time monitoring to keep this intricate system running smoothly around the clock.Renewable energy sources like solar and wind are variable, and without a flexible grid, they can lead to instability. SolarEPC Energy Management System, SPARK, is engineered to address this by integrating high levels of on-site renewables, such as rooftop solar, into industrial energy systems. It enhances operational stability through smart management of Lithium-Ion storage.Digitization also helps lower the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) of energy systems. This is achieved through improved load management, reduced breakdowns and leaks, proactive maintenance, and efficient economic order dispatch that ensures the lowest Levelized Cost of Energy (LCOE). Key features of SPARK include:Economic Order Dispatch: Automatically selects the most cost-effective power source in a multi-source setup. Load Optimization for Telecom Towers: Balances demand and supply through internal reallocation, deferring CAPEX. Proactive Maintenance: Minimizes unplanned downtime, equipment failures, and risks from faulty equipment. Moreover, digitization provides real-time monitoring and enhanced transparency using Advanced Computer Vision, Machine Learning, and Blockchain technologies.
